There is no such thing as the fastest way to relieve neck pain after sleeping. Neck pain after sleeping is mainly considered to be caused by neck muscle spasm, which can be relieved by general treatment, physical therapy and medication.
1. General treatment: usually by adjusting the sleeping position, massage the neck muscles and replace the appropriate pillow, usually can be relieved.
2. Physical therapy: If the symptoms of neck pain are more obvious, you can use hot compresses, acupuncture and physical therapy such as infrared radiation to increase blood circulation in local tissues, remove inflammatory factors and relieve neck pain symptoms.
3. Medication: If the neck pain is more intense, you can take ibuprofen extended-release capsules, loxoprofen sodium tablets and other non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s for anti-inflammatory and pain relief treatment. You can also take baclofen tablets and other drugs to relieve muscle spasms.
In addition, patients should raise their heads more and lower them less in daily life to reduce the causes of cervical spondylosis. If the symptoms worsen, they should go to regular hospitals for consultation.
